Da Nang increasingly favoured by tourists

During the first days of 2024, Da Nang happily welcomed about 402,000 visitors, an increase of 37% over the same period in 2023, nearly 177,000 of whom were foreigners. This shows that Da Nang is still a popular destination for both domestic and international tourists.

One of the advantages that tourists highly appreciate is that Da Nang regularly refreshes its tourist attractions.

For example, during the recent 2024 Lunar New Year holiday break, many miniature Tet decorations were installed, attracting a large number of tourists for enjoyment. Not to mention, tourist areas and attractions also have numerous highly - inviting entertainment activities and art performances to serve tourists.

Arriving in Da Nang from the Zhao Shang Yi Dun cruise ship on February 14, Ms. Chen Liu Yang, a Chinese tourist, spent a lot of time going out and visiting areas near the city centre. She said that before her Da Nang trip, she had only known that Da Nang was a coastal city. When she arrived, she was quite surprised by the vibrant and bustling atmosphere.

Even though the first days of the Lunar New Year have passed, the Tet atmosphere was still bustling with brightly-decorated streets. Because the ship stayed overnight at the Tien Sa port, Ms. Yang and many other tourists had more time to visit the Sun World Ba Na Hills and museums.

In addition to attractions and check-in venues in the city centre, many tourists choose these tourist attractions for spring travel at the beginning of the year.

Recently, bus route No.3, connecting the Da Nang International Airport with the Sun World Ba Na Hills tourist area, has been put into operation, contributing to increasing the choice of transportation solutions for tourists when coming to Da Nang.

The Sun World Ba Na Hills tourist area also has launched many art programmes and festivals to better serve both residents and tourists.

Ms. Song Min He, a South Korean national said that the reason for choosing the Sun World Ba Na Hills in her family's itinerary is because this place is both a spiritual place to celebrate at the beginning of the year and has spring festival activities with interesting experience.

To enrich tourism products in the city, the Da Nang Tourism Promotion Centre has renewed tourism products from cyclos. The fleet of 83 cyclos is uniformly designed in style, colour, size, outfit, especially the drivers' straw hats with the Danang Fantasticity logo, contributing to bringing a more beautiful image to Da Nang.

A representative of the Da Nang Tourism Promotion Centre said that members of the tourist cyclo team meet health standards, understand traffic laws, foreign languages and have knowledge of local attractions.

Every year, team members participate in the centre-held training courses on foreign languages, knowledge and skills on civilised culture and behaviour in serving tourists.

Thanks to these aforementioned preparations, the tour around the city by cyclo helps tourists enjoy and explore the inner city of Da Nang such as Han River, Dragon Bridge, Han River Bridge, Cham Sculpture Museum, APEC Sculpture Garden Park, Han Market and the Da Nang Cathedral has just enjoyed local cuisine with a 30-45 minute journey chosen by many tourists, especially international visitors.

It is known that by 2024, the Da Nang tourism industry aims to welcome 8.4 million tourists. The increase in the number of domestic and international visitors to Da Nang during the recent Lunar New Year holiday break is a positive sign for the city’s tourism.

According to Deputy Director of the Department of Tourism Tan Van Vuong, given the large number of visitors in the first days of the Lunar New Year, Da Nang continues to accelerate promotion activities and enhance the quality of the existing tourism products and services. Along with that is diversifying services, products, and increasing experiences to meet the increasing needs of tourists.

The tourism industry is focusing on organising research on trends and tourist tastes in key and potential markets, forecasting the market situation and organising appropriate tourism stimulation activities. Also, the city will search for new and potential markets and market segments and develop online platforms targeting international markets such as Douyin (Taiwan, China) and Naver (South Korea).

The city will promote the hiring of Da Nang tourism representatives in key international markets, with a heed to re-nominating Da Nang tourism representatives in South Korea and Japan in 2024 and those in China, India, Australia and Indonesia in 2025.

Regular and charter international routes from China and the Da Nang - Doha direct flight to reconnect with North American and European markets will be restored.

Besides, there will be a rise in the number of flights connecting Da Nang to Indonesia, India, Japan (Nagoya, Osaka), Phuket (Thailand), northeast Thailand and Gangwon (South Korea).
